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Movin' in the Right Direction! is a vibrant and contemporary 20-minute program designed to help build character and integrity in your young singers. Teachers, students, and parents will enjoy the lessons that can be learned through this presentation. The texts reinforce positive concepts and goals. The seven songs, set in a wide variety of musical styles, may be sung separately or put together with the connecting narrations (35 spoken lines in all). Recommended for grades 2--7.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This memoir of life as a committed pedestrian in a beautiful Southern city explores the many joys and benefits of walking as a way of life. Raised on the notion that driving is the essence of freedom, many of us still cling to the belief that the American Dream is defined by a house in the suburbs and a car in the garage. But in Why I Walk, Kevin Klinkenberg shares a very different dream life—and a very different kind of freedom. A few years ago, Kevin moved to Savannah, Georgia, from Kansas City, Missouri. In large part, he chose his new home because he was seeking a truly walkable place to live. Going beyond the typical arguments against suburbia, he shows how walking on a daily basis has improved his health, finances, social life, and sense of personal freedom. By focusing directly on the real, measurable advantages of choosing to be a pedestrian, Why I Walk makes a convincing case for ending our love affair with the automobile—and rekindling the romance of walking.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Poetry. Translated from the Danish by Barbara Haveland. A STEP IN THE RIGHT DIRECTION is a series of meditations on walking. Divided into four major songs, or cantos, each one explores the act of walking from a different point of view: As a social activity; as an act of love; as a condition for thought; and as an inspiration for art. In this new collection, Morten S ndergaard continues a line of thought he first developed in Bees Die Sleeping and continued in VINCI, LATER (which was published in English in 2005).
